> This is a spinoff from SOLR-14033. HDFS tests on windows are currently
> disabled. They fail because when hadoop tries to link a native library it
> fails with an unchecked exception that propagates up the stack and leaves
> tons of stuff initialized and not cleaned up (internal jetty for the
> namenode, etc.), eventually leading to thread leaks and havoc.
> This issue is about handling this situation gracefully - ignoring the test
> and cleaning up properly.
> This will also render tests.disableHdfs useless but I'd mark all these tests
> as slow (because they are).
